
Qoohoo is a social platform that allows creators to build engaging communities.
Vimal and Aseem Gupta started Qoohoo in 2020 with an aim to empower creators to launch their communities swiftly with immersive engagement and fast content creation. The app is currently in private beta mode (Android and iOS) and will be revealing more information in the near future. The Bengaluru-based startup is backed by investors such as Alvin Tse (country manager of Xiaomi Indonesia), Gaurav Munjal (founder of Unacademy ), Hugo Amsellem (investor in Creator Economy), Kalyan Krishnamurthy (CEO of Flipkart ), Sujeet Kumar (co-founder of Udaan ), Kunal Shah (founder of CRED ) among others. In March 2021, Qoohoo raised seed funding of $800,000 from a consortium of investors.
